## Deployment

The Murkstone cache tier places a bloom filter in front of the Keldvault key-value store to avoid pointless disk lookups on missing keys. The filter is rebuilt on every deploy from a snapshot, so expect elevated false-positive rates for the first few minutes after rollout. If lookup latency climbs afterward, check the filter saturation metric before paging storage. The deployment applies the filter configuration listed below.

service settings:
[oliix]
team = noveth
access_code = ac_4de949
host = oliix.novachq.corp
port = 8080
owner = wenir.casion
peer = wenys.lumicstack.corp

Subject: Handover — QuotaWeaver per-tenant rate quotas

Hi Marisol,

Taking over release duties for QuotaWeaver this cycle. Current state: the per-tenant rate quota service is on release 4.2, with the burst-multiplier change held back pending load tests on the Delvane cluster. Tenants flagged in the overrides file keep legacy limits until their contracts renew. Please double-check the quota snapshot diff before each rollout; a silent mismatch burned us last quarter. The deploy artifacts must be signed with the key below.

signing key of fajop-tahop = bky9_qdL6xeDv7

- [ ] **Step 7: Breaker override escrow.** After sealing the signing keys for the Tallgrove upstream API circuit breaker, confirm the support team can force the breaker open during a full outage. The override bundle lives in the sealed escrow drawer and is useless without its unlock phrase. Two ceremony witnesses must initial this step before proceeding. The escrow bundle is decrypted with the recovery passphrase that follows.

vault phrase of kahip-kahop = holath-quenmir